Understanding Property Management Fee Structures

When it comes to property management fees, there’s no one-size-fits-all approach. However, understanding the common fee structures can help you better evaluate your options and choose the right fit for your investment strategy.

The most prevalent fee structure in the industry is based on a percentage of the monthly rent collected. This model aligns the property management company’s interests with those of the property owner, as both parties benefit from maximizing rental income. In 2025, we anticipate that the average percentage-based fee will range from 7% to 11% of the monthly rent, depending on various factors such as property type, location, and the scope of services provided.

Some property management companies, including Pacific West Property Management, offer tiered pricing models that adjust the percentage based on the number of units under management. This approach can be particularly advantageous for investors with larger portfolios, as it often results in lower overall management costs.

Alternatively, a fixed fee structure may be offered, especially for single-family homes or smaller multifamily properties. While this model provides predictable costs for property owners, it’s essential to carefully review what services are included to ensure you’re getting the best value for your investment.

Additional Fees and Services to Consider

While our standard management fee covers many essential services, there are some additional fees and services that property owners should be aware of when budgeting for property management in 2025.

Leasing fees, for example, are often charged separately from the ongoing management fee. These fees typically cover the costs associated with marketing the property, showing it to potential tenants, and executing the lease agreement. In 2025, we expect leasing fees to range from 50% to 100% of one month’s rent, depending on market conditions and the complexity of the leasing process.

Maintenance and repair costs are another important consideration. While routine maintenance is often included in the standard management fee, more significant repairs or renovations may incur additional charges. Factors Influencing Property Management Pricing

Several factors can influence the pricing of property management services. Understanding these elements can help you better evaluate different management options and negotiate terms that work best for your investment strategy.

Property type and size play a significant role in determining management fees. Single-family homes, for instance, may have different management requirements compared to large multifamily complexes or commercial properties. The location of your property also impacts pricing, with urban areas like Vancouver often commanding higher fees due to increased market competition and regulatory complexities.

The condition and age of your property can affect management costs as well. Newer or recently renovated properties typically require less maintenance and may qualify for lower management fees. Conversely, older properties or those in need of significant upgrades may require more intensive management and thus incur higher fees.
